Summary

  • Seattle’s backups produced just 156 total yards and 27 after halftime in a 17-7 preseason loss to Dallas, giving Macdonald what he called a clear list of operational problems.
  • Macdonald pointed to communication, motion, shifts and defensive alignment, saying those details must improve quickly before Friday’s joint practice and next Sunday’s preseason game in Tennessee.
  • Drew Lock went 9-of-13 for 40 yards and a touchdown and pushed the ball downfield, while Jalen Milroe finished 5-of-8 for 36 yards with 36 rushing yards but took a costly 14-yard sack on fourth down.
  • Seattle’s reserve offensive line also struggled, with running backs gaining 65 yards on 22 carries and the unit drawing five penalties; Logan Brown was flagged three times.
  • Bud Clark logged 45 snaps in a quiet debut at deep safety, and Seattle is expected to test the second-round pick more in Nashville as it gauges depth before Week 1.
